One of the crucial aspects of production planning is to ensure that you have enough of each material you will need to begin production. This is where production planning frameworks such as Material Requirements Planning (MRP) come into play. MRP was developed to help manufacturers carry out an efficient strategy to order and organize materials waiting to be assembled. What is MRP?Material Requirements Planning (MRP) refers to the process that translates master schedule requirements for finished goods into time-phased requirements for raw materials, components, parts, and sub-assemblies. While the master schedule designates the quantity and need dates of the end items, material requirements planning generates a production plan that indicates the timing and quantities of all materials required to produce those end items. Functions of MRPHaving a systematized method of planning your materials will keep your production planning, inventory control, and purchasing departments aligned and keep materials moving through the facility. Although an MRP system cannot run a production facility on its own, it allows manufacturers to maintain a steady flow of materials through the supply chain and permits planners to focus their attention on problematic areas. The main objective of material planning is to balance the demand for materials with the supply of materials so that an appropriate quantity of materials is available when they are needed.
What is the main focus of the MRP?MRP systems focus specifically on planning and controlling how goods are assembled using multiple raw materials or components by controlling inventory, componentry and the manufacturing process.
What is the importance of material planning?When done correctly, material requirements planning helps to ensure that there are enough materials and components available for production. It also helps to determine how much finished goods and by what date will be available for shipping to the customer.
What is the main concern of material planning management process and why it is important?Materials management is an aspect of supply chain management and planning. The primary purpose of materials management is to ensure that manufacturers have all the raw materials they need to make goods.
